I.G.I. 2: Covert Strike offers a challenging and engaging experience that encourages strategic thinking, problem-solving, and hand-eye coordination through its blend of stealth and first-person shooter mechanics. Players must plan their approach, adapt to dynamic situations, and utilize a diverse arsenal of weapons to complete objectives. The game's emphasis on player choice in mission execution promotes creative solutions and adaptive challenge.

The game contains frequent realistic violence and some language, as reflected in its M rating. The narrative may present a simplified and potentially biased geopolitical perspective, characteristic of Cold War-era spy thrillers. While the game lacks modern monetization and social risks, the competitive multiplayer mode could expose players to toxicity, and the representation of women and ethnic diversity is limited. Some violence is directed at defenceless targets.
